/*
    File Name:      main.css
    Description:    Skārda Nams website.
    Version:        V1
    Author:         Zigurds Gavars
    Author URI:     http://www.html-advisor.com/
*/
html,body{
    font:12px Arial, Helvetica, sans-serif;
    color:#666;
    height:100%;
    margin:0;
    padding:0;
    border:0;
    background: #B1DBB7 url(../img/bg.jpg) repeat}
h1,h2,h3,h4,h5,h6{
    font-size:14px;
    margin:0;
    padding:0}
h3{
    font-size:12px;
    font-weight:bold;
    color:#000}
h4{
    color:#38332D;
    font-size:12px;
    font-weight:normal;
    /*padding:0 0 0 19px;*/
    margin:0;
    /*background:url(../img/bgh4.gif) 0 0 no-repeat*/}
a{
    color:#666;
    text-decoration:none;
    outline:none}
a:hover{
    text-decoration:underline}
a:active,a:link,fieldset{
    border:0;
    outline:none}
em{
    font-style:normal;
    color:#00944B}
#wrp{
    position:relative;
    top:0;
    width:100%;
    min-height:100%;
    height:auto !important;
    height:100%;
    margin:0 0 -90px 0}
#cont{
    position:relative;
    top:0;left:50%;
    width:900px;
    height:auto;
    padding:130px 0 0 0;
    margin:0 0 0 -450px;
    z-index:2;
    overflow:hidden}
#hd{
    position:absolute;
    top:0;
    width:100%;
    height:189px;
    background:url(../img/top_bg.jpg) repeat-x;
    z-index:1}
    #hdi{
        position:relative;
        width:900px;
        height:175px;
        margin:0 auto;
        padding:0;}
#menu{
    float:left;
    width:261px;
    height:auto;
    margin:0;
    background:url(../img/m_bg.jpg) repeat-y;
    overflow:hidden}
    #mtop{
        height:auto;
        background:url(../img/m_b.jpg) no-repeat left bottom}
    #menu ul{
        height:auto;
        list-style:none;
        overflow:hidden}
    #mmain{
        padding:35px 15px 22px 15px;
        margin:0;
        background:url(../img/m_t.jpg) no-repeat left top}
        #mmain h2{
			background: url(../img/ico/li1.gif) 11px top no-repeat;
            height:24px;
            padding:0 0 0 36px;
            margin:0;
            font-size:12px;
            line-height:24px;
            color:#333}
		#mmain li li {
			background: url(../img/ico/li2.gif) 6px 4px no-repeat;
			padding: 2px 0 3px 25px
		}
		#mmain li li li {
			background: url(../img/ico/li3.gif) left 4px no-repeat;
			padding: 2px 0 3px 19px
		}
        #pg1,#pg2,#pg3,#pg4{
            margin:12px 0 0 0;
            padding:0 0 11px 0;
			background: url(../img/dash_b.gif) 6px bottom no-repeat}
        #menu ul.ml1{
            height:100%;
            padding:0;
            margin:0 0 0 12px}
        ul.ml2{
            padding:0;
            margin:0}
        #pg1{
            margin-top:0;
            padding-top:0;}
        #pg4{
            background-image: none}
        #mmain li.nb{
            background:none}
#page{
    float:right;
    width:630px;
    height:auto}
    #page h2{
        height:24px;
        margin:5px 0 5px 5px;
        padding:0;
        font-size:13px;
        font-weight:bold;
        line-height:24px;
        color:#333;
        background:url(../img/ico/li4.jpg) no-repeat}
        #page h2 b{
            padding:0 10px 0 8px}
        #page h2.h2f{
            padding-left:30px}
        #page dl,#page dt,#page dd{
            padding:0;
            margin:0}
            #page dl{
                background:url(../img/box_bg.jpg) 0 33px no-repeat;
                height:386px}
            #page dt{
                background:url(../img/box_t.jpg) 0 0 no-repeat;
                height:18px;
                padding:15px 0 0 19px;
                font-size:13px;
                font-weight:bold;
                color:#333}
            #page dd{
                background:url(../img/box_b.jpg) 0 bottom no-repeat;
                height:341px;
                padding:8px 70px 5px 28px}
            #page dd a{
                color:#4E945A;
                text-decoration:underline}
            #page dd a:hover{
                color:#81BC8B;
                text-decoration:none}
            #page dd p{
                padding:0 0 14px 0;
                margin:0}
            #page dd ul{
                padding:0 0 7px 10px;
                margin:0}
			#page dd ul li{
				background: url(../img/ico/li2.gif) left 2px no-repeat;
				list-style-type: none;
                padding:0 0 5px 20px;
                margin:0}
    #lgbg{
        position:absolute;
        top:22px;left:5px;
        height:55px;
        width:138px;
        background:#F00;}
    #logo{
        position:absolute;
        top:14px;
        left:11px;
        width:230px;
        height:79px;
        padding:0;
        margin:0;
        background:url(../img/logo.gif) no-repeat}
        #logo a{
            display:block;
            width:237px;
            height:0;
            padding:79px 0 0 0;
            overflow:hidden}
        #tm{
            position:absolute;
            top:0;
            right:0;
            margin:69px 50px 0 0;
            list-style:none;
            overflow:hidden;
            display:inline;
            z-index:30}
            #tm li{
                float:left;
                margin:0;
                padding:0;
                line-height:12px;
				font-size: 11px;
				color: #9CA5A5}
			#tm li a{
				font-size: 11px;
				color: #9CA5A5}
			#tm li a:hover {
				color: #73B57E;
			}
            li#tmi1,li#tmi2,li#tmi3{
                width:11px;
                height:10px;
                background-repeat:no-repeat}
			li#tmi1{
				margin: 0 9px 6px 78px;
			}
			li#tmi2{
				margin: 0 9px 6px 0;
			}
			li#tmi3{
				margin: 0 0 6px 0;
			}
                #tmi1 a,#tmi2 a,#tmi3 a{
                    display:block;
                    overflow:hidden;
                    width:11px;
                    height:0;
                    padding:10px 0 0 0;}
            #tmi1{
                background-image:url(../img/ico/icohome.gif)}
            #tmi2{
                background-image:url(../img/ico/icocontact.gif)}
            #tmi3{
                background-image:url(../img/ico/icobookmark.gif)}
            li#tmi4{
                margin:0 10px 0 20px;
                padding:0 10px 0 0;
                border-right:1px solid;
				clear: left;}
    #bcr{
        height:28px;
        margin:17px 0 -45px 6px;
        padding:0 0 0 19px;
		z-index: 999;
        list-style:none;
        line-height:28px;
		position: relative;}
        #bcr li{
            float:left;
			font-size: 15px;
			font-weight: bold;
			color: #333333}
    #gs{
        position:relative;
        top:0;
        width:593px;
        height:475px;
        margin:0;
        padding:0;
        list-style:none;
        background:url(../img/house.jpg) left top no-repeat}
        #gs li{
            position:absolute;
            width:25px;
            height:25px;
            margin:0;
            padding:0}
        #g01{
            top:73px;
            left:308px}
        #g02{
            top:127px;
            left:309px}
        #g03{
            top:156px;
            left:258px}
        #g04{
            top:195px;
            left:195px}
        #g05{
            top:137px;
            left:449px}
        #g06{
            top:246px;
            left:276px}
        #g07{
            top:327px;
            left:201px}
        #g08{
            top:305px;
            left:387px}
        #g09{
            top:152px;
            left:480px}
        #g10{
            top:75px;
            left:375px}
        #g11{
            top:189px;
            left:319px}
        #gs a{
            display:block;
            width:25px;
            height:25px;
            line-height:25px;
            text-align:center;
            color:#333}
            #gs a:hover{
                text-decoration:none}
    #dyn{
        height:auto;
        overflow:hidden}
        ul#prgr{
            margin:0;
            padding:0;
            overflow:hidden}
            ul#prgr li{
                float:left;
                width:184px;
                height:146px;
                margin:0 0 0 1px;
                padding:10px 0 10px 12px;
                list-style:none;
                background:url(../img/pgibg.png) no-repeat;
                display:inline}
            ul#prgr span{
                font-size:11px;
                color:#666;
                display:block;
                padding:4px 0 2px 0}
            ul#prgr p{
                padding:0 0 3px 0;
                margin:0;
                height:70px}
                ul#prgr p img{
                    float:left;
                    margin:0 3px 0 0;
                    border:1px solid #81BC8B}
            ul#prgr strong{
                font-weight:normal;
                color:#333}
            ul#prgr a{
                margin:5px 0 0 0;
                display:block;
                padding:0 0 0 18px;
                background:url(../img/bgmore.gif) 0 0 no-repeat}
                ul#prgr a:hover{
                    background:url(../img/bgmoreo.gif) 0 0 no-repeat}
.clr{
    clear:both}
.ddt,.ddb{
     float:left;
     width:264px;
     height:100px}
     .ddt p{
        margin:0;
        padding:0 0 0 20px !important;
        font-size:11px;
        color:#666}
     .ddt strong{
        padding:0 0 0 20px;
        color:#333}
     .ddb img,.ddt img{
        margin:5px 0 0 0}
.brdr{
    border:1px solid #999}
.info{
    padding:4px 0 0 25px;
    margin:0;
    color:#333}
.hidden{
    visibility:hidden}
#TB_window a:link,#TB_window a:visited,#TB_window a:hover,#TB_window a:active,#TB_window a:focus{
    color:#34911B;
    text-decoration:none;
    font-weight:bold}
a.nlink{
    color:#38332D !important;
    font-weight:normal !important;
    text-decoration:none !important}
    a.nlink:hover{
        text-decoration:underline !important}
		
#kontaktforma {
	background: url(../img/box_bg2.jpg) left top no-repeat;
	height: 458px;
	padding: 0 0 17px 0;
	border: 0;
	margin: 0;
}

#cont #page #kontaktforma dl,
#cont #page #kontaktforma dd,
#cont #page #kontaktforma dt {
	background-image: none;
}

#cont #page #kontaktforma dd {
	padding: 20px 70px 5px 28px;
}
		
#kontaktforma fieldset{
    padding:0;
    border:0;
    margin:0}
    #kontaktforma ol{
        margin:8px 8px 5px 0;
        padding:0;
        list-style:none}
    #kontaktforma li{
        padding:4px 0;}
    #kontaktforma label{
        font-weight:bold;
        color:#555;
        width:160px;
        display:block;
        float:left}
    #kontaktforma input{
        width:250px;
        border:1px solid #99C9A2}
    #kontaktforma textarea{
        width:360px;
        height:130px;
        border:1px solid #99C9A2}
    #kontaktforma input.btn{
        border:0;
        width:100px;
        height:25px;
        background:url(../img/bgbtn.gif) no-repeat;
        font-weight:bold;
        color:#333}
    #kontaktforma legend{
        color:#666;
        margin:0;
        padding:0;
        text-indent:0}
#error,#gutt{
    margin:280px 0 0 290px;
    width:140px;
    padding:3px;
    color:#000;
    text-align:center;
    border:1px solid;
    position:absolute}
    #error{
        border-color:#B74D4D;
        background:#FFBABA}
    #gutt{
        border-color:#749074;
        background:#E9FDE4}
#ft,.spc{
    height:57px}
#ft{
    height: 40px;
    padding: 50px 0 0 0;
    text-align:center;
    background: url(../img/ftr_bg.jpg) repeat-x}
	#ft p{
		margin: 0;}
    #ft .p{
		padding: 4px 0 0 0;
		color: #999999;
		font-size: 11px;}
		
		
	

#dhtmltooltip {
	position: absolute;
	left: -300px;
	width: 130px;
	height: 50px;
	padding: 15px 10px 0 10px;
	background: transparent url(../img/tooltip.gif) left top no-repeat;
	visibility: hidden;
	z-index: 999;
	text-align: left;
	font-size: 11px;
	color: #828282;
}
#dhtmltooltip b {
	color: #333333;
	font-size: 12px;
	display: block;
	padding-bottom: 2px;
}

#dhtmlpointer{
	position:absolute;
	left: -300px;
	z-index: 101;
	visibility: hidden;
}

